I was happily surprised by how this show turned out! I'm so glad they made sure to not make it about underaged relationships but about turning your life around and having a second chance. It really was uplifting and a fun watch. I thoroughly enjoyed the characters, especially the adult-turned-teenage ones. Hishiro was hilarious, and Arata was the type of gentlemen I wish I could encounter more often.

If you were worried that this would be an old guy after teenage girls like I was, then don't worry. Luckily, it is mainly pedophile-free . . .

Oh, and make sure to watch the four OVA episodes to feel the show has a good, solid conclusion.

Story:

The protagonist suffers from a trauma and lost all his self confidence because of something that happened in his past. He goes back to high school under the premise of "taking a drug that makes you look younger" in the ReLIFE experiment, and there he interacts with some people while the surveillance keeps an eye on him. The execution was well done for the most part, however it feels like they gave too much attention to the "trauma" in a few of the later episodes, going as far as dedicating an entire episode to it after already vaguely explaining the situation multiple times before.

Animation: The animation was pretty good. All characters looked nice and detailed. Occasional slapstick animation was used, but it was used fittingly. The failing fake smile from Hishiro and general facial animations were good and detailled.

Sound: The OP was very unfitting. It sounded more like a happy go lucky anime than an anime which would actually be themed on depression. There should have been some darker sounding parts in it, like with Boku Dake.

The background music of the anime didn't leave an impression on me at all. Having recently watched the likes of Flying Witch my expectations might be a bit higher, though this anime didn't have any noticable themes that stick with you.

A different ending every time sounds like fun, but a lot of them sounded very similar and tbh I can't remember a single one of them. 

The sound had a huge quantity, however the quality was pretty bad.

Characters:

Aside from the support staff, the cast reminded me very much of Clannad which I explain later on in the spoilers part. The only real characters that were interesting to me where the white knights, but they didn't get much attention at all.

Kariu was probably the most interesting and realistic character of all of them. She really captures the essention of a lot of tsundere teen girls: they want you to understand and feel for them, but not say it out loud because it emberasses them, and they want you to ignore their verbal cues but analyse the entire situation to see whether you really understand them or just pretend to.

Conclusion:

Ironically I won't go too much into the conclusion in this part, because most of it is actually spoilers. The premise of the anime seemt original, but if you take away the part that he's an adult in a teen body before it's actually just very simillar to a lot of other anime's out there

One thing I really liked is that they aired the entire anime in one go. In hindsight it probably mean anything to most people who didn't watch it within the season, but for me binge watching it was a lot more pleasant than waiting for it every week, and I would have probably dropped it around episode 8 if I didn't binge watch it. In the end it was decent entertainment and though it doesn't really contain any amazing life lessons it was still a good ride.

Spoilers/reflection

The premise for the story is in hindsight actually very unoriginal, but it looks like a combination between multiple animes, but it especially reminded me of Clannad part 1, where Tomoya is a "dumb deliquent" on low self confidence, who regains his motivation in life by helping others, along with another very big similarity between the two. Tomoya also gains motivation to study, but is more emotional smart than book smart, and "changes others around him" also Clannad spoiler both protagonists end up with a socially awkward girl who couldn't get any friends.

One of the problems I've had with the anime is that the "support" staff is really that in definition too. They have a bit of a personality but they don't really do anything aside from a little intervention in the later episodes. In the end all they did for me was give the anime an introduction and confirm that Hishiro, which I initially suspected to be another experiment runner, was indeed one. I totally forgot about her having a support, so I didn't really make the connection between her and Onoya , especially since Onoya pretty much directly ruined Kaizaki's motivation to make moves on Hishiro by saying he shouldn't get with "high school girls" before which Yoake really had to make a push for in the end.

The anime had no solid ending of Kaizaki and Hishiro getting together, which is mostly so that people will root for a season 2, or maybe an OVA or a movie or something I think. I found it a bit strange that they refused to give it a solid ending, even in just a picture with them together as older versions, because the MC wasn't suffering from the usual "harem syndrome" in which he had to choose for multiple girls. In the end had just one choice with which he would obviously get shipped.

Also the white knight squad Inukai and Asaji seemt like the guys with the biggest problems in the entire anime, I really wonder why those two weren't addressed at all. That story would have interested me a lot more than the excessive flashbacks and background story of his boss and his shit workplace.
